Miller Road is in Croydon and in Croydon district. CR0 3JZ is located in the Broad Green elect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Croydon North.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Gender

In the UK, the overall gender distribution is approximately 49% male and 51% female. However, the area surrounding CR0 3JZ has a female population much higher than UK average, with 57.2% of the population being female. Several factors can contribute to this. Women generally live longer than men, resulting in a higher proportion of women in neighborhoods with significant elderly populations. Typically, as people grow older, they tend to relocate from city center addresses to suburban areas, smaller towns, and rural locations. Consequently, these areas often have a higher number of females. A higher female population can also be found in areas with industries that employ more women, such as healthcare, education, and retail.

Partnership Status

Across the UK, the average relationship status breakdown is roughly 44% married, 38% single, 9% divorced, 6% widowed, and 2% separated.

In the immediate area around CR0 3JZ, a significant portion of the population is single, making up 47.9% of the residents. On average, approximately 38% of individuals who responded to the census in the UK were single. Areas with higher single populations are typically urban centers, university towns, regions with dynamic job markets, rich cultural offerings and entertainment facilities. These regions also tend to have a younger demographic.

Safety

Is Miller Road d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Miller Road was 111.7 per 1,000 residents, which is 35.4% lower than the Broad Green average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

Miller Road has the 43rd lowest crime rate of 106 local areas in Broad Green and the 340th highest crime rate of 1,082 local areas in Croydon .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 43.6 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has risen by about 25.8%.
